Unadjusted coefficient | 95% CI | p-value | Adjusted coefficient# | 95% CI | p-value | |
Intercept | −0.60 | −0.73 – −0.47 | <0.001 | −0.85 | −1.08 – −0.62 | <0.001 |
Time | −0.06 | −0.09 – −0.05 | <0.001* | −0.08 | −0.11 – −0.05 | <0.001* |
CFTR modulator | 0.003 | −0.15–0.15 | 0.959 | 0.05 | −0.10–0.19 | 0.537 |
Time : CFTR modulator | 0.13 | 0.05–0.21 | 0.002* | 0.14 | 0.06–0.22 | <0.001* |
Interpretation: the intercept represents the mean BMI Z-score at the time of CFTR modulator initiation (baseline) in children under 19 years (according to World Health Organization growth reference standards). The coefficient of time indicates the mean annual change in BMI Z-score in the years before modulator initiation. The coefficient of CFTR modulator reflects the acute change in BMI Z-score after modulator initiation, whereas time : CFTR modulator represents the change in annual BMI Z-score in the years after CFTR modulator initiation compared to the years before. BMI: body mass index. CFTR: cystic fibrosis transmembrane conductance regulator. #: coefficients were adjusted for the main effects of sex, age at baseline, the interaction effect of sex with time and the interaction effect of age at baseline with time; *: significance level p<0.05.
